LADWP scrambling to prepare dusty Owens Valley for possible floods

Overflow from the Owens River creates a mirror pond near Bishop reflecting the snow-capped Sierras. (Mark Boster / Los Angeles Times)

by Louis Sahagun
Los Angeles Times


Lone Pine, Calif. -- As snow continued to fall on the eastern Sierra Nevada on Monday, platoons of earth movers, cranes and utility trucks fanned out across the Owens Valley, scrambling to empty reservoirs and clean out a lattice-work of ditches and pipelines in a frantic effort to protect the key source of Los Angeles’ water.

With snowpack levels at 241% of normal, Los Angeles Mayor Eric Garcetti a week ago issued an emergency declaration allowing the Department of Water and Power to take immediate steps to shore up the aqueduct and its $1-billion dust-control project on dry Owens Lake, which L.A. drained to slake its thirst in the last century.

DWP activities have always elicited concern in the Owens Valley, given the history of a water war that began when Los Angeles agents posed as ranchers and farmers to buy land and water rights in the area. Their goal was to build the aqueduct system to meet the needs of the growing metropolis 200 miles to the south.

The stealth used to obtain the region’s land and water rights became grist for books and movies that portrayed the dark underbelly of Los Angeles’ formative years, and inspired deep-seated suspicions about the city’s motives that linger to this day.

Officials insist that the current emergency poses a real threat not just to urban Los Angeles’ residents, but to the ranchers, farmers, outdoor enthusiasts and small-business owners living in the sage-scented high desert gap between the fang-like peaks, some taller than 14,000 feet, of the Sierra Nevada to west and the White and Inyo ranges to the east.

“Conditions of extreme peril” threaten residents and ecosystems, Garcetti said. The 1 million acre-feet of water expected to flow through the century-old aqueduct system this spring and summer could possibly overflow the web of concrete channels, spilling into fields, homes and businesses.

The danger of destructive flooding and the utility’s responses to it are raising tensions between Los Angeles and the Owens Valley towns along a 110-mile stretch of U.S. 395 in a rural region defined by water wars since the early 1900s.

The crews swarming the valley are focused on protecting DWP infrastructure and U.S. 395, the principle route between Southern California and eastern resort areas, leaving some townsfolk fretting they are being overlooked.

The emergency is already taking toll on the tourism industry in a stunning landscape of snow-capped peaks, cascading streams, dormant volcanoes, small towns and sage plains dotted with irrigated pastures — most of them leased from the DWP.

The Bishop Chamber of Commerce & Visitors Bureau, for example, was forced to cancel the 50th annual Blake Jones Trout Derby scheduled for March 11 after the DWP rescinded its permission to hold the event because of dangerously high waters spilling over the banks of the Owens River, just north of town.

“Losing the derby was a $300,000 hit to the local economy,” said Tawni Thompson, director of the chamber. “We’ll never know how many vacationers decided not to come through Bishop because they were scared of dying in a flood.”

“I’m going to declare a state of emergency,” she added, “if our tourism industry goes down the toilet.”

Bernadette Johnson, superintendent of the Manzanar National Historic Site on U.S. 395, has been getting nowhere with requests for additional flood control measures along streams on DWP land just outside the boundaries of the location that was a Japanese American internment camp during World War II.

“We were hit by destructive flooding earlier this year, and in 2013 and 2014,” Johnson said. “But the DWP is saying that when all hell breaks loose they won’t have enough resources and manpower to help us. We have to wonder about their priorities.”

In long legal battles spanning decades, the DWP was eventually forced to give up significant amounts of water to steady water levels in Mono Lake, re-water parts of dry Owens Lake to help prevent dust storms and restore a 62-mile stretch of the Lower Owens River.

Many residents suspect that the DWP plans to use emergency declarations to bypass rules and regulations that have prevented it in the past from constructing paved roads, for example, on Owens Lake, which is owned by the State Lands Commission.

Richard Harasick, head of the DWP’s water system, dismissed that notion: “The department is not using this emergency declaration to take some sort of advantage or build special projects that would otherwise have to go through the normal regulatory process.”

“It is as much to help us manage the anticipated floodwaters as to aid in public safety,” he said. “It allows us to get goods, services and contracts faster, from heavy equipment to riprap needed to shore up banks and channels.”

This week, Inyo, Kern and Mono counties were expected to issue their own emergency declarations, making them eligible for state and federal assistance in the event of flooding.

“My proclamation will ask for critical resources,” Inyo County Administrator Kevin Carunchio said. “In the meantime, I want every DWP facility, ditch, diversion bypass, canal and conveyance structure available and operating as soon as possible.”

The region has a history of destructive floodwaters rushing off the High Sierra.

In August 1989, for example, cloudbursts driven by 60-mph winds gouged out the underpinnings of the aqueduct near Cartago and closed a 63-mile stretch of U.S. 395.

Jon Klusmire, administrator of the Eastern California Museum in Independence, isn’t taking any chances with the little institution located along a usually docile creek.

“I’ve devised a survival strategy for a worst-case scenario,” he said. “I’m going to jam some boards in a nearby DWP diversion gate, then dig a ditch to divert the water away from the museum and into the streets.”

The big question for Kathy Jefferson Bancroft, tribal historic preservation officer for the Lone Pine Paiute-Shoshone Reservation, is this: “How could it be that Los Angeles never developed a plan B in a place where massive snowpack and destructive flooding go with the terrain?”

Standing on a berm overlooking on the plots of vegetation, gravel and shallow flooding the DWP has constructed across 50 square miles of dry lake bed over the past 20 years, Bancroft said, “They’ve reduced dust pollution here by 96% with these projects, and they’re all going to be underwater soon.

“Honestly, I’m looking forward to seeing this lake filled up again, like it is supposed to be,” she said.

That vista will be short-lived. The runoff is expected to evaporate within 12 to 18 months, leaving behind an already existing repair job for dust abatement and system improvements expected to cost up to $500 million, officials said.

The rebuilding effort will be done in cooperation with state and federal regulatory agencies, local authorities and stakeholders, the State Lands Commission, which owns the lake bed, and the Great Basin Unified Air Pollution Control District, which is responsible for protecting the health of Owens Valley residents.

“When we’re done, it’ll be something different than what exists today,” Harasick said. “That’s because we plan to make it more flood-resilient.”

The Drought Goes On: As Lake Mead Sinks, States Agree to More Drastic Water Cuts

Lake Mead, the West's largest reservoir, is dropping at a rapid rate.

Written by Sarah Tory
Coachella Valley Independent


Three years ago, state hydrologists in the Colorado River Basin began to do some modeling to see what the future of Lake Mead—the West’s largest reservoir—might look like. If the dry conditions continued, hydrologists believed, elevations in Lake Mead—which is fed by the Colorado River—could drop much faster than previous models predicted.

For decades, the West’s big reservoirs were like a security blanket, says Anne Castle, the former assistant secretary for water and science at the Interior Department. But the blanket is wearing thin. Under normal conditions, Lake Mead loses 1.2 million acre-feet of water every year to evaporation and deliveries to the Lower Basin states plus Mexico; that all amounts to a 12-foot drop. Previously, extra deliveries of water from Lake Powell offset that deficit, but after 16 years of drought and increased water use in the Upper Basin, those extra deliveries are no longer a safe bet.

“There’s a growing recognition that even these huge reservoirs aren’t sufficient to keep the water supply sustainable anymore,” says Castle.

For the three Lower Basin states—California, Arizona and Nevada—that rely heavily on Lake Mead, the situation is particularly urgent. For the last several years, Mead has hovered around 1,075 feet above sea level, the point at which harsh water-rationing measures kicks in. And if conditions in the reservoir continue to worsen, the Interior Department could even take control of water allocation from Lake Mead.

So with the threat of a federal takeover looming, water policy leaders in the Lower Basin states, along with the Bureau of Reclamation, the reservoir’s operator, began meeting last summer to discuss ways they can jointly boost water levels in Lake Mead. Some of the details are now available and indicate that all three states are now willing to accept additional water cuts from the reservoir on top of the cuts that they previously agreed to make in 2007.

Those measures follow a set of federal guidelines adopted nine years ago to manage water deliveries from Lake Mead, given the likelihood of future shortages. The guidelines established a series of thresholds for the reservoir’s water levels that would trigger increasingly severe cutbacks for the Lower Basin states. At the time they were negotiated, few people anticipated that the drought would last as long as it has, but as Lake Mead inched closer to the critical 1,075 mark, water managers in the Lower Basin realized the existing guidelines were not enough to prevent an eventual shortage.

While the terms of the new agreement between California, Arizona and Nevada are still being negotiated, a few details have emerged. For starters, the Bureau of Reclamation has pledged to cut 100,000 acre-feet annually through efficiency measures such as lining irrigation canals to prevent seepage, or possibly by re-opening the long-shuttered Yuma Desalting Plant.

The three states’ willingness to collectively ration their water use would have been unthinkable just a few decades ago, when states fought each other in court to win as much water from the Colorado River. The cooperation is a nod to how new climate realities are re-shaping old water politics in the West. Take California, for instance. Legally, the state could hold on to every drop until Lake Mead is nearly down to mud, since the 1968 law that authorized the Central Arizona Project’s construction gave California the highest priority water rights to the Colorado River. But at that point, says Castle, they’re just as impacted as everyone else.

Other collaborative agreements to reduce the strain on the Colorado River include a 2014 Memorandum of Understanding between the big water providers in the Lower Basin states, the Bureau of Reclamation and the Central Arizona Project, pledging “best efforts” to conserve 40,000 acre feet in Lake Mead. In 2014, major municipal water providers in Arizona, California, Nevada and Colorado also agreed to fund new water conservation projects through a pilot initiative called the Colorado River System Conservation program.

For the Lower Basin especially, the negotiations are necessary to avoid the potential federal takeover, says Tom Buschatzke, the director of the Arizona Department of Water Resources. Although the secretary of the interior, Sally Jewell, has not voiced any immediate plans to that effect, in the past, she has made public statements on the matter.

For Buschatzke, the threat is clear: “She’ll take action if we don’t collaborate,” he says.

Here are the cuts states could face:

Arizona would lose 512,000 acre-feet of its total 2.8 million acre-feet per year allotment if Lake Mead dips below the 1,075 feet threshold. That’s 192,000 acre-feet more than the 320,000 acre-feet it had previously agreed to cut under the 2007 guidelines. Further cuts occur if the reservoir continues to drop. In another unprecedented move, Arizona water officials are talking about trying to spread cuts across all sectors of the state’s economy that rely on CAP water for drinking and irrigation—cities, farms, industries, Indian tribes and others—instead of letting only farmers take the brunt of the cuts, as dictated by their junior water rights.

California: Thanks to the 1968 law that authorized CAP’s construction, California’s 4.4 million acre feet allotment is shielded from most of the cuts should a shortage on Lake Mead be declared. But as part of the new negotiations, the state has volunteered to cut its water use from Lake Mead by 200,000 acre feet if the reservoir’s levels fall below 1,045 feet, and up to 350,000 acre-feet if levels sink to 1,030 feet.

Nevada: The state with the smallest allotment of Colorado River water, Nevada would take a much smaller share of the cuts—8,000 acre-feet if Mead drops below 1,045 feet, and 10,000 acre-feet after that—because it has the rights to only 300,000 acre-feet.

According to Buschatzke, the three states anticipate finalizing the agreement by early this fall, at which point negotiators will begin working the new measures into law. Those changes in law will likely not happen before 2017.

For Castle, the discussions are part of a new era in water politics—one that looks increasingly collaborative.

“We haven’t seen states versus state or state versus feds for a long time,” she says. “There’s a recognition that litigation is failure—that we need to come together and make things work.”
